In every network bus there is a situation of an output signal calculated on the base of few input signals. This is implemented by function, written on program language. When entire program is realized it will be written in flash memory of the controller that transmits the signals. In many cases output signal values are formed in clusters, groups with same output value and close input values. In present investigation different methods of approaches are engaged and their positive and negative sides are compared. Algorithms for founding boundaries of such clusters using polynomials are suggested in the paper. Methods for their realizations by functions with minimal usage of memory (flash and RAM) are suggested. Neural networks are also investigated in such direction.
